Hans de Goede
d4a5df521d hwdb: Add quirk to fix mapping of T-bao Tbook air touchpad toggle key
The touchpad toggle key (Fn + Esc) on the T-bao Tbook air sends CTRL +
META + scancode 0x76 without this quirk. With this quirk it sends CTRL +
META + F21, with F21 mapping to XF86TouchpadToggle, which is what we want.

Note that the CTRL + META modifiers being send together with the F21 are
still somewhat unusual, userspace will need to be thought to deal with
this as there is nothing we can do about this at the hwdb level. Note at
least one other laptop also sends CTRL + META + F21 instead of just F21.

Iago López Galeiras
574432f889 job: truncate unit description
The comment above says we're truncating the string but that's not true,
an assert will fail in xsprintf if the description is longer than
LINE_MAX.

Let's use snprintf instead of xsprintf to make sure it's truncated.
We'll cast its result to void to tell static checkers we're fine with
truncation.
